What are atoms made of?

Are you ready to have your mind totally blown?! Look at your hands, the walls, and the screen you are reading this on. Everything around you is made of tiny, invisible building blocks called atoms! But what is an atom actually made of? Join Mira and Finn on a zooming, shrinking adventure into the smallest things in the entire universe! You'll discover that a single grain of sand has over fifty quintillion atoms inside it (that’s a five with nineteen zeros!). But the craziest part? Atoms are almost completely empty space! You'll hear the wild true story of Ernest Rutherford firing speeding particles at a super-thin sheet of gold foil, only to find out they bounced straight back! We'll shrink down past the tiny nucleus to find even tinier things like protons, neutrons, and funny-sounding particles called quarks. Learn how scientists used a two-mile-long machine to smash atoms together, and find out what would happen if you squeezed all the empty space out of every single human on Earth (Hint: we would all fit inside a single, incredibly heavy sugar cube!). Get ready to shrink down to the quantum level!
